Anesthesia Equipment, 3rd Edition is a comprehensive reference that provides detailed information on the use of anesthesia equipment today. It offers objective, informed answers to ensure optimal patient safety and meets both equipment and patient care challenges. The book covers the latest machines, vaporizers, ventilators, breathing systems, vigilance, ergonomics, and simulation, and includes ASA Practice Parameters for care. It also offers detailed advice on risk management and medicolegal implications of equipment use, with hundreds of full-color line drawings, photographs, graphs, and charts.
